The Iowa Mennonite School volleyball team scored a road Southeast Iowa Superconference win Tuesday night in Letts, topping Louisa-Muscatine in four sets.
IMS was a winner by scores of 27-25, 22-25, 25-14 and 25-10. IMS was led on the night by Mia Graber with 11 kills. Rachel Miller had 28 digs. With the win, IMS improves to 6-13 on the year. They will next be in action Thursday when they host Mediapolis.
